Analyzing Self-Explanations in Mathematics: Gestures and Written Notes Do Matter

When learners self-explain, they try to make sense of new information. Although research has shown that bodily actions and written notes are an important part of learning, previous analyses of self-explanations rarely take into account written and non-verbal data produced spontaneously.
